Text

1.Except when responding to an emergency, a special guardian of a person of limited capacity shall apply to the court for instruction or approval before commencing any act relating to the person of limited capacity.
2.The court may grant a special guardian of a person of limited capacity the power to manage and dispose of the estate of the protected person pursuant to NRS 159.117 to 159.175 , inclusive, and perform any other act relating to the protected person upon specific instructions or approval of the court.
